| Specification | Tecno Spark 30 Pro | Vivo Y200 |
|---|---|---|
| Price in Pakistan | ||
| Retail price | PKR 59,999 | PKR 57,999 Cheaper |
| Design & build | ||
| Release date | September 2024 | 2024 (expected in Pakistan) |
| Dimensions | 166.6 × 77 × 7.4 mm | 164.1 × 74.8 × 7.95 mm |
| Weight | 189 g | 188 g Better |
| Water resistance | IP54 Dust & Splash Resistant | Not listed |
| Display | ||
| Screen size | 6.78 Inches Better | 6.67 inches |
| Resolution | 1080 × 2436 Pixels (Full HD+) Better | 1080 × 2400 pixels (~395 ppi) |
| Panel type | AMOLED, 1 Billion Colors 120Hz Always-On Display (AOD) Punch-hole design 10-bit color support Wet Touch technology Multi-touch capacitive touchscreen | AMOLED, 120Hz, HDR10+ |
| Protection | Not officially specified | Schott Xensation glass |
| Performance | ||
| Chipset | MediaTek Helio G100 (6nm) | Qualcomm Snapdragon 685 (6 nm) |
| CPU | Octa-core 2× Cortex-A76 @ 2.2GHz 6× Cortex-A55 @ 2.0GHz | Octa-core (4×2.8 GHz Cortex-A73 & 4×1.9 GHz Cortex-A53) |
| GPU | Mali-G57 MC2 | Adreno 610 |
| Operating system | Android 14 with HiOS 14.5 | Android 14, Funtouch OS 14 |
| Memory & storage | ||
| RAM | 8GB (Up to 8GB Memory Fusion) | 8 GB + 8 GB Extended |
| Internal storage | 128GB / 256GB UFS 2.2 Better | 128 GB |
| Card slot | microSDXC (Dedicated slot, market dependent) | Yes, microSD up to 1TB |
| Camera | ||
| Main camera | 108 MP, Wide, f/1.9, PDAF (Auto Focus) Secondary Camera: Auxiliary AI Lens Quad-LED Flash HDR Panorama AI Camera Super Night Mode Portrait Mode Pro Mode Time-Lapse Slow Motion Document Scanner Beauty Mode Better | 50 MP (wide, OIS) + 2 MP (depth) |
| Selfie camera | 13MP Dual-color LED Flash HDR | 32 MP (wide) Better |
| Video recording | 1440p (2K) 1080p @30fps 720p @30fps | 1080p@30fps, HDR, Dual-View Video |
| Battery & charging | ||
| Battery capacity | Li-Ion (non-removable) 5000 mAh | Non-removable Li-Po 5000 mAh |
| Wired charging | 33W Fast Charging | 80W wired fast charging Better |
| Connectivity & extras | ||
| SIM | Dual Nano-SIM (Dual Standby) | Dual Nano-SIM, IP54 dust and splash resistant |
|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ac Dual-Band Wi-Fi Direct Hotspot |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band |
| Bluetooth | 5.3 A2DP LE | 5.0 |
| NFC | Yes | No |
| Sensors | Under-Display Optical Fingerprint Face Unlock Accelerometer Gyroscope Electronic Compass Ambient Light Sensor Proximity Sensor | In-display fingerprint, accelerometer, proximity, compass |
| USB | USB Type-C 2.0, OTG | USB Type-C 2.0, OTG |
“Better” marks the higher (or, for price and weight, the lower) figure. It is a specification difference, not a judgement about real-world experience.

Tecno Spark 30 Pro is listed at PKR 59,999 and Vivo Y200 at PKR 57,999. That makes Vivo Y200 cheaper by PKR 2,000. Retail prices move often, so treat these as indicative.
Vivo Y200 scores higher in our camera assessment. Tecno Spark 30 Pro uses a 108 MP main sensor against 50 MP on Vivo Y200, though sensor size and processing matter more than resolution alone.
Vivo Y200 leads on battery. Tecno Spark 30 Pro carries a 5000 mAh cell and Vivo Y200 a 5000 mAh cell, with 33W and 80W wired charging respectively.
